- 1、本文档共10页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
非线性动态系统的仿真运行规范
非线性动态系统的仿真运行规范
一、非线性动态系统仿真运行的基本概念与重要性
非线性动态系统是一类具有复杂行为特征的系统,其动态特性通常表现为非线性的数学关系,例如混沌、分岔、极限环等现象。这类系统在自然界和工程领域中广泛存在,例如生态系统、电力系统、机械系统等。仿真技术作为研究非线性动态系统的重要工具,能够通过数学模型和计算机模拟,揭示系统的内在规律和行为特征。然而,由于非线性动态系统的复杂性和敏感性,仿真运行过程中容易出现误差积累、数值不稳定等问题,因此制定科学合理的仿真运行规范至关重要。
仿真运行规范的核心目标是确保仿真结果的准确性、可靠性和可重复性。首先,仿真模型的选择和构建是仿真运行的基础。非线性动态系统的模型通常包括微分方程、差分方程或状态空间方程等形式,建模过程中需要充分考虑系统的非线性特性、参数不确定性以及外部扰动等因素。其次,仿真算法的选择直接影响仿真结果的精度和效率。对于非线性动态系统,常用的仿真算法包括欧拉法、龙格-库塔法、变步长算法等,不同的算法在计算精度、稳定性和计算复杂度方面存在显著差异。此外,仿真参数的设置和初始条件的选取也是影响仿真结果的重要因素。
在仿真运行过程中,还需要关注数值计算的稳定性和误差控制。非线性动态系统对初始条件和参数变化极为敏感,微小的误差可能导致仿真结果的显著偏差。因此,在仿真运行中需要采用适当的误差控制策略,例如自适应步长算法、误差估计和校正技术等,以确保仿真过程的稳定性和结果的可靠性。同时,仿真结果的验证和验证也是仿真运行规范的重要组成部分。通过与实验数据或理论分析结果的对比,可以评估仿真模型的准确性和仿真算法的有效性,从而为进一步的优化和改进提供依据。
二、非线性动态系统仿真运行的关键技术与方法
非线性动态系统仿真运行涉及多种关键技术和方法,这些技术和方法的选择和应用直接影响仿真结果的准确性和效率。
1.模型构建与参数估计
非线性动态系统的模型构建是仿真运行的基础。在建模过程中,需要根据系统的物理特性和行为特征,选择合适的数学模型。例如,对于机械振动系统,可以采用非线性微分方程描述其动态行为;对于生态系统,可以采用非线性差分方程或状态空间模型。在模型构建完成后,需要对模型参数进行估计和校准。参数估计通常基于实验数据或历史数据,采用最小二乘法、最大似然估计等统计方法进行优化。
2.仿真算法的选择与优化
仿真算法的选择是影响仿真结果精度和效率的关键因素。对于非线性动态系统,常用的仿真算法包括显式算法和隐式算法。显式算法(如欧拉法、龙格-库塔法)计算简单,但稳定性较差,适用于低精度要求的仿真任务;隐式算法(如隐式欧拉法、梯形法)稳定性较好,但计算复杂度较高,适用于高精度要求的仿真任务。在实际应用中,可以根据仿真任务的需求,选择合适的算法或采用混合算法以提高仿真效率。
3.误差控制与稳定性分析
非线性动态系统对初始条件和参数变化极为敏感,仿真过程中容易出现误差积累和数值不稳定问题。因此,误差控制和稳定性分析是仿真运行的重要环节。误差控制技术包括自适应步长算法、误差估计和校正技术等,能够根据仿真过程的动态特性,自动调整仿真步长和计算精度,以提高仿真结果的可靠性。稳定性分析则通过研究仿真算法的稳定域和收敛性,评估仿真过程的数值稳定性,从而为算法的选择和优化提供依据。
4.仿真结果的验证与验证
仿真结果的验证和验证是确保仿真结果准确性和可靠性的重要步骤。通过与实验数据或理论分析结果的对比,可以评估仿真模型的准确性和仿真算法的有效性。验证方法包括定量分析(如误差分析、相关系数分析)和定性分析(如行为特征对比、趋势分析)等。此外,还可以采用敏感性分析和不确定性分析,研究模型参数和初始条件对仿真结果的影响,从而为进一步的优化和改进提供依据。
三、非线性动态系统仿真运行的应用与实践
非线性动态系统仿真运行在多个领域具有广泛的应用价值,以下从工程领域、自然科学领域和社会经济领域三个方面,探讨其应用与实践。
1.工程领域的应用
在工程领域,非线性动态系统仿真运行广泛应用于机械系统、电力系统、控制系统等的设计和优化。例如,在机械振动系统中,仿真技术可以用于研究非线性振动现象(如混沌、分岔)及其对系统性能的影响,从而为机械结构的设计和优化提供依据。在电力系统中,仿真技术可以用于研究电力网络的稳定性、故障传播特性等,从而为电力系统的规划和运行提供支持。在控制系统中,仿真技术可以用于研究非线性控制策略的有效性和鲁棒性,从而为控制系统的设计和优化提供参考。
2.自然科学领域的应用
在自然科学领域,非线性动态系统仿真运行广泛应用于生态系统、气候系统、生物系统等的研究。例如,在生态系统中,仿真技
文档评论(0)